﻿@charset "utf-8";
/* CSS Document */
* {
	margin: 0px;
	padding: 0px;
	border-top-width: 0px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-left-width: 0px;
}
div.articleBK
{
	position:absolute;
	background-image:url(../images/content.gif);
	background-repeat:no-repeat;
	width:400px;
	height:600px;
	overflow:hidden;
	z-index:1001;
}
div.article
{
	position:relative;
/*	width:360px;
	height:400px;
	overflow:auto;
	cursor:hand;
	padding:100px 20px 100px 20px;*/
	word-wrap:break-word; 
	line-height:20px;
}
div.inleft
{
	white-space:normal;
	width:180px;
	word-wrap:break-word;  
}
div.inright
{
	white-space:normal;
	width:180px;
	word-wrap:break-word;  
}
body {
	font-family:Arial;
	font-size: 12px;
	color: #575757;
	background-color: #FFFFFF;
	text-align: center;
}
#box {
	width: 1000px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#D2D2D2;
	border-left-color: #D2D2D2;
	margin: 0 auto;
}
#title {
	background-image: url(../images/titlelogo.gif);
	background-position:bottom;
	background-repeat:no-repeat;
	height: 250px;
	width: auto;
}
#languagelist{
	margin-left:282px;
	margin-top:210px;
}
#languagelist li{
	height:35px;
	line-height:35px;
	width:80px;
	vertical-align:middle;
	text-align:center;
	margin-left:3px;
	float:left;
	filter:progid:DXImageTransform.Microsoft.gradient(startcolorstr=#3fc9ff,endcolorstr=#0096d1,gradientType=0);
}
#languagelist li a{
	display:block;
}
#languagelist li a:link,#languagelist li a:visited{
	font-family:Arial;
	font-size:15px;
	font-weight:bold;
	color:#FFFFFF;
	text-decoration:none;
}
#menu {
	height: 45px;
	width: 100%;
}
#menubg {
	height: 45px;
	width: auto;
	filter:progid:DXImageTransform.Microsoft.gradient(startcolorstr=#ffffff,endcolorstr=#96cfff,gradientType=0);
}
div.titleword{
	color:#000000;
	cursor:hand;
}
span.titleword1{
	color:#A0A0A4;
	cursor:hand;
}
#banner {
	height: 200px;
	width: auto;
	margin-top: 14px;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#E5E5E5;
}
#main {
	height:auto;
	width: 1000px;
	position:relative;
	top:0px!important;
	top:-45px;
}
#left {
	padding-top:12px;
	float: left;
	height: auto;
	width: 204px;
	border-right-width: 0px;
	border-right-style: solid;
	border-right-color: #D6D6D6;
}
#center {
	float: left;
	height: auto;
	width: 570px;
	text-align: left;
	padding-top: 12px;
	padding-left: 10px;
	padding-right: 10px;
}
#right {
	padding-top:12px;
	float: right;
	height: auto;
	width: 204px;
	border-right-width: 0px;
	border-right-style: solid;
	border-right-color: #D6D6D6;
}
#leftpic {
	writing-mode:tb-rl;
	Text-align:left;
	background-color: #7BBECE;
	background-image: url(../images/323.gif);
	background-repeat: repeat-y;
	float: left;
	height: 680px;
	line-height:45px;
	vertical-align:middle;
	width: 45px;
	font-size:45px;
	font-family:Arial;
	font-weight:bold;
	color:#FFFBF0;
}
#leftmenu {
	text-align: left;
	float: right;
	height: 680px;
	width: 200px;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#D6D6D6;
}
#rightpic {
	writing-mode:tb-rl;
	Text-align:left;
	background-color: #7BBECE;
	background-image: url(../images/323.gif);
	background-repeat: repeat-y;
	float: right;
	height: 680px;
	line-height:45px;
	vertical-align:middle;
	width: 45px;
	font-size:45px;
	font-family:Arial;
	font-weight:bold;
	color:#FFFBF0;
}
#rightmenu {
	text-align: left;
	float: left;
	height: 680px;
	width: 200px;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#D6D6D6;
}
#fightcont {
	height: 376px;
	width: auto;
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#C7C7C7;
}
#r_leftcont {
	float: left;
	height: 375px;
	width: auto;
}
#r_lefttitle {
	background-image: url(../images/339.gif);
	background-repeat: repeat-x;
	height: 68px;
	width: auto;
}
div.title {
	line-height: 34px;
	height: 34px;
	width: auto;
	text-indent: 20px;
	vertical-align:middle;
	border-width: 1px;
	border-style:solid;
	border-color: #ceebff;
	font-family:Arial;
	font-size:14px;
	font-weight:bold;
	color:#111111;
	filter:progid:DXImageTransform.Microsoft.gradient(startcolorstr=#97cfff,endcolorstr=#ffffff,gradientType=0);
}
.news{
	color: #B98697;
	height: auto;
	padding-top:5px;
	padding-bottom:10px;
	width: auto;
}
.news li{
	height: 18px;
	line-height: 18px;
	vertical-align:middle;
	text-align:left;
	background-image: url(../images/349.gif);
	background-repeat: no-repeat;
	background-position: 17px;
	text-indent: 28px;
	list-style-type: none;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#EAF4F3;
	padding:0px;
	cursor:hand;
}
li{
	text-align:center;
	background-repeat: no-repeat;
	list-style-type: none;
}
/*#price{
	line-height: 30px;
	color: #B98697;
	height: 30px;
	width: auto;
	vertical-align:middle；
}*/
#rpic {
	float: right;
	height: 375px;
	width: 165px;
}
#list {
	height: 280px;
	width: 395px;
}
#listpic {
	line-height: 30px;
	font-weight: bold;
	color: #B98697;
	text-align: center;
	float: left;
	height: 280px;
	width: 220px;
}
#listcont {
	float: right;
	height: 280px;
	width: 456px;
}
#listcont li {
	line-height: 30px;
	list-style-type: none;
}
#bottom {
	background-image: url(../images/343.gif);
	background-repeat: repeat-x;
	height: 74px;
}
.r0 {width:204px;}
.r15 {
	line-height: 34px;
	height: 34px;
	width: auto;
	vertical-align:middle;
	text-align:center;
	font-family:Arial;
	font-size:14px;
	font-weight:bold;
	color:#111111;
background-image:url(../images/leftright.gif);}
.r16 {
	line-height: 34px;
	height: 34px;
	width: auto;
	vertical-align:middle;
	text-align:center;
	font-family:Arial;
	font-size:14px;
	font-weight:bold;
	color:#111111;

background-image:url(../images/leftright.gif);
background-position:-2px;border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ff;}
.r1 {height:2px; font-size:1px; overflow:hidden; display:block; background-color:#9ad0ff; margin:0 20px;}
.r2 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:3px solid #9ad0ff; border-left:3px solid #9ad0ff; margin:0 18px;}
.r3 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:3px solid #9ad0ff; border-left:3px solid #9ad0ff; margin:0 15px;}
.r4 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:3px solid #9ad0ff; border-left:3px solid #9ad0ff; margin:0 13px;}
.r5 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 11px;}
.r6 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 9px;}
.r7 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 7px;}
.r8 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 5px;}
.r9 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 4px;}
.r10 {height:2px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 3px;}
.r11 {height:1px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 2px;}
.r12 {height:1px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 1px;}
.r13 {height:1px; font-size:1px; overflow:hidden; display:block; border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; margin:0 1px;}
.r14 {border-right:2px solid #9ad0ff; border-left:2px solid #9ad0ff; padding:0px 5px 0px 5px;}

#menutitle{  
	margin:0 auto;  
	position:relative;
	top:-45px;
	height:45px;
	margin: 0 auto;
	z-index:1000;
	width:832px!important;  
	clear:both  
}  
#menutitle ul{  
  list-style:none;  
}  
#menutitle li {  
  float:left;  
  position:relative;  
}     
#menutitle ul ul {  
  visibility:hidden;  
  position:absolute;  
  left:0px;  
  top:45px;   
  filter:progid:DXImageTransform.Microsoft.gradient(startcolorstr=#96cfff,endcolorstr=#ffffff,gradientType=0);
  background-color:#FFFFFF;
  padding-bottom:10px;
}  
#menutitle table{  
  position:absolute;  
  left:0;  
  top:0;  
}  
#menutitle ul li:hover ul,#menu ul a:hover ul{  
  visibility:visible;  
}  
#menutitle a.title{  
  display:block;  
  text-align:center;  
  text-decoration:none;  
  width:104px;  
  height:45px;  
  line-height:14px;  
  font-family:Arial;
  font-size:14px;
  font-weight:bold;
  color:#000000;
  vertical-align:middle;  
}  
#menutitle a div{position: absolute;top: 50%;width:100%;cursor:hand;text-align:center;left:0;}
#menutitle a p{position: relative;top: -50%}
#menutitle a.title:hover{  
  background:url(../images/title1.gif);
}  
#menutitle ul ul li { 
  height:auto; 
  clear:both;  
  text-align:left;  
}  
#menutitle ul ul li a{  
  display:block;  
  width:104px;  
  height:auto;
  font-family:Arial;
  font-size:14px;
  font-weight:bold;
  color:#000000;  
  padding-top:5px;
  padding-bottom:5px;
  padding-left:5px;
}  
#menutitle ul ul li a:hover{  
  color:#0096d1;  
}  

.buttont{
width:100%;
}

.buttontb
{
	height:34px;
	line-height:34px;
	vertical-align:middle;
	text-align:center;
	border:5px solid #ffffff;
	background-image:url(../images/button.jpg);
}
.buttontl
{
	height:34px;
	line-height:34px;
	vertical-align:middle;
	text-align:center;
	background-image:url(../images/button.jpg);
	border-bottom:5px solid #ffffff;
	border-top:5px solid #ffffff;
	border-right:5px solid #ffffff;
	border-left:0px;
}
.buttontr
{
	height:34px;
	line-height:34px;
	vertical-align:middle;
	text-align:center;
	background-image:url(../images/button.jpg);
	border-bottom:5px solid #ffffff;
	border-top:5px solid #ffffff;
	border-left:5px solid #ffffff;
	border-right:0px;
}
a.title
{
  display:block;  
  text-decoration:none;  
  font-family:Arial;
  font-size:12px;
  font-weight:bold;
  height:34px;
  color:#000000;
}

a.leftmenu{
  display:block;  
  text-decoration:none;  
  font-family:Arial;
  font-size:13px;
  font-weight:bold;
  color:#000000;
  word-wrap:break-word; 
}
input
{
	border-width:1px;
	border-color:#ffffff;
	background-color:#c9defa;
}
textarea
{
	border-width:1px;
	border-color:#ffffff;
	background-color:#c9defa;
}

div.loadWindows{
	background-color:#ffffff;
	text-align:center;
	margin:0px;
	padding:0px;
	border:0px;
	width:100%;
	height:100%;
	overflow:hidden;
}
div.loadup{
	background-image:url(../images/loadup.gif);
	position:relative;
	border:0px;
	width:800px;
	height:150px;
	margin:0px;
	padding:0px;
	overflow:hidden;
}	
	
div.loaddown{
	background-image:url(../images/loaddown.gif);
	position:relative;
	border:0px;
	width:800px;
	height:150px;
	margin:0px;
	padding:0px;
	overflow:hidden;
}	
div.loadform{
	background-image:url(../images/loadform.gif);
	position:relative;
	border:0px;
	width:800px;
	height:0px;
	margin:0px;
	padding:0px;
	overflow:hidden;
}	

div.loadbutton{
	position:absolute;
	border:0px;
	width:71px;
	height:81px;
	margin-top:120px;
	margin-left:60px;
	padding:0px;
	overflow:hidden;
}	
div.loadname{
	position:absolute;
	border:0px;
	width:160px;
	margin-top:100px;
	margin-left:-100px;
	padding:0px;
	text-align:left;
	font: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	left: 376px;
	top: 30px;
	overflow:hidden;
}	

div.loadpassword{
	position:absolute;
	border:0px;
	width:160px;
	margin-top:100px;
	margin-left:-100px;
	padding:0px;
	text-align:left;
	font: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	left: 375px;
	top: 60px;
	overflow:hidden;
}	

input.txt{
	height:15px;
	width:80px;
}

input.button{
	background-image:url(../images/loadbutton.gif);
	cursor:hand;
	border:0px;
	padding:0px;
	margin:0px;
	width:71px;
	height:81px;
}	

div.register{
	position:absolute;
	background-color:#ffffff;
	filter:alpha(opacity=95);
	font-size:14px;
	font-family:"宋体";
	font-weight:normal;
	text-align:inherit;
	color:#000000;
	WORD-BREAK:break-all;
	width:0px;
	height:0px;
	line-height:20px;
	overflow:auto;
	z-index:1000;
	padding:20px 10px 20px 10px;
	visibility:hidden;
	overflow:hidden;	
}